Weather: ‘Cold invasion’ with heavy rain and snow, an emergency EMY bulletin is expected

Warning for "potentially dangerous phenomena" at the weekend

Newsroom November 28 07:38

 

The weather will change scenery from tomorrow (29/11), as the weather is expected to worsen, with rain, snow and a drop in temperature.

In fact, as the director of the National Meteorological Service (EMF), Thodoris Kolydas, said in a post, from Friday (29/11) phenomena start to appear in the west and north and the weather in the country begins to gradually change over the weekend. On Saturday and Sunday we will have rain and thunderstorms in most of the country, which will be locally strong.

According to him, the feasibility of issuing an emergency weather bulletin will be considered today.

Arnaoutoglu warns of “potentially dangerous weather” over weekend

“In the next 24 hours a change in weather is expected that appears to be severe. A lot of water will fall for hours in many areas of the country. In some of them the phenomena cannot be ruled out to be potentially dangerous,” Sakis Arnaoutoglou said in a post.

The weather will start to show its “teeth” from Friday evening. “On Saturday, we will be visited by a low barometric pressure that will give us a lot of water and in some places a lot of water,” the meteorologist says.

Northern Greece will see a lot of water and the rains will be long lasting. At the same time in Florina, Kastoria and maybe even Kozani, it will snow.

The temperature dropped to -5 °C on Wednesday morning, 27/11/2024

Frost occurred in the morning hours of Wednesday 27/11 in the northern and central continental parts, with the lowest minimum temperature recorded for another day in Fort Nefrokopi where the mercury dropped to -5.2 °C. The weather today

Scattered clouds are expected, becoming occasionally thicker in the west and north. During the night and early morning visibility will be limited in many areas and fog will form in places.

The temperature will range in Western Macedonia from -2 to 13 degrees Celsius, in the rest of northern Greece from -5 to 14 degrees Celsius, in Thessaly from 1 to 17 degrees Celsius, in Epirus from 2 to 18 degrees Celsius, in the rest of the mainland from 2 to 18-20 degrees Celsius, in the Ionian Islands from 6 to 17-18 degrees Celsius, in the islands of the North and Northeastern Aegean from 3 to 16 degrees Celsius and in the rest of the Aegean islands and in Crete from 6 to 17-19 degrees Celsius.

In the North Aegean, winds will blow from the east with intensities of 2-4 Beaufort and in the rest of the Aegean winds from the north with the same intensities. In the Ionian Sea and on the mainland, light winds will prevail.

FRIDAY 29-11-2024

In the west, increasing clouds with local rain and occasional thunderstorms.
In the rest of the country a few clouds that will gradually increase and from the afternoon hours showers and isolated thunderstorms will occur in the north and the eastern Aegean, while from the evening local showers will occur in the rest of the country and mainly in the Cyclades and Crete.
In the morning and evening hours visibility will be locally limited.
Winds will blow from southerly directions 3 to 5 Beaufort and from the evening hours in the north north north-northeasterly 4 to 6 Beaufort.
The temperature will not show any significant change. It will reach 16 degrees Celsius in the northern mainland and 17 to 20 degrees Celsius in the rest of the country.

SATURDAY 30-11-2024

Change of weather across the country with showers and occasional thunderstorms, possibly strong in places, mainly in the west, central and north.
Snow will fall in the northern mountains.
Visibility will be locally limited during the phenomena.
Winds will blow south 5 to 7 Beaufort, in the west and north east northeast 6 to 7 and locally in the northern Aegean up to 8 Beaufort.
The temperature will drop in the north.

SUNDAY 01-12-2024

Unsettled weather with showers and thunderstorms. The phenomena are likely to be strong in places mainly in the central and northern mainland and from the afternoon in the eastern Aegean. In the afternoon and evening hours they will show a temporary decline in the west.
Snow will fall in the central and northern mountains.
Visibility will be locally limited during the phenomena.
Winds will blow in the west and north east northeast at 4 to 6 Beaufort and in the north at 8 to 9 Beaufort. In the remaining areas the wind will blow from the south at 5 to 7 Beaufort with a tendency to weaken from the afternoon hours.
The temperature will drop in almost the whole country.

MONDAY 02-12-2024

Unsettled weather with showers and occasional thunderstorms, mainly in the eastern mainland and the Aegean Sea. Gradually the phenomena will gradually subside in the west. Snow will fall in the mountains, mainly in the central and northern parts of the country.
Visibility will be locally limited during the phenomena.
Winds will blow in the west and north, east northeast 4 to 6 and locally in the northern Aegean Sea 7 Beaufort. In the remaining areas the wind will blow from southern directions 4 to 5 Beaufort.
The temperature will drop slightly further.
